Up, Up and Away

11.2 million percent. That’s Zimbabwe’s latest count on its hyper-inflation. It is astronomical, nearly comical because of its absurdity. But the reality of this economic collapse is terrifying. The latest numbers from the World Food Program (WFP) estimates 83% of Zimbabwe’s population are living off of less than two US dollars a day. Imagine trying to feed yourself, [...]
